Output 0617437058294a3203eb2c7d4dca24a560536bf63923b92159f077ea126308d2:1

value
54229
script pubkey
OP_0 OP_PUSHBYTES_20 f80313cc52092dd319a3ce7d10c2e7b57346d4a5
address
bc1qlqp38nzjpykaxxdree73psh8k4e5d4995fxvze
transaction
0617437058294a3203eb2c7d4dca24a560536bf63923b92159f077ea126308d2
confirmations
53342
spent
true